En el vertiginoso mundo del diseño digital de 2026, la diferencia entre una plataforma que se siente estancada y una que cautiva al usuario reside en los detalles del movimiento. Las transiciones animadas que mejoran la experiencia visual no son simplemente adornos estéticos; son el tejido conectivo que da coherencia a una interfaz, reduce la carga cognitiva y guía la mirada del espectador de manera intuitiva.
Cuando un usuario navega por un sitio web o una aplicación, espera una respuesta inmediata y lógica a sus acciones. Una transición brusca puede desorientar, mientras que una transición bien ejecutada crea una sensación de continuidad y calidad. En este artículo, exploraremos en profundidad cómo utilizar el movimiento para transformar la usabilidad y por qué el diseño de interacción es hoy más relevante que nunca.
El papel de las transiciones en la psicología del usuario
Para comprender por qué las transiciones son vitales, debemos mirar cómo funciona el cerebro humano. Nuestros ojos están programados para detectar el movimiento, una herencia evolutiva que hoy aplicamos a las pantallas. En el diseño de interfaces, el movimiento comunica estado, jerarquía y relación.
Reducción del cambio ciego y la desorientación
El "cambio ciego" ocurre cuando un elemento desaparece y otro aparece instantáneamente sin previo aviso. El cerebro tarda unos milisegundos en procesar este cambio, lo que genera una pequeña fricción. Las transiciones animadas eliminan este problema al mostrar el recorrido de los elementos, permitiendo que el usuario entienda de dónde viene la información y hacia dónde se dirige.
Mejora de la percepción de velocidad
Paradójicamente, añadir una animación puede hacer que un sitio web parezca más rápido. Aunque la animación consume tiempo, la fluidez visual elimina la sensación de "espera" estática. Un indicador de carga que se transforma suavemente en el contenido final es mucho más satisfactorio que una pantalla en blanco que parpadea repentinamente.
Tipos de transiciones animadas esenciales para interfaces modernas
No todas las animaciones cumplen la misma función. Para optimizar la experiencia visual, es necesario clasificar y aplicar el movimiento según el objetivo narrativo de la interfaz.
Transiciones de navegación jerárquica
Estas son las que ocurren cuando el usuario se desplaza entre diferentes niveles de información. Por ejemplo, al hacer clic en una tarjeta de producto para ver los detalles, el uso de una transición de elementos compartidos (donde la imagen de la tarjeta se expande para convertirse en la cabecera de la página de detalles) crea una conexión visual poderosa y lógica.
Microinteracciones de feedback
El feedback visual es la respuesta a una acción específica del usuario, como pulsar un botón, marcar una casilla o deslizar un interruptor. Estas transiciones deben ser extremadamente rápidas (menos de 300ms) para que se sientan como una respuesta física directa a la interacción táctil o del cursor.
Transiciones de entrada y salida de contenido
El orden en que los elementos aparecen en pantalla (staggering) ayuda a establecer la jerarquía. En lugar de que todos los elementos carguen a la vez, una ligera transición secuencial indica al usuario por dónde empezar a leer. Este es un uso estratégico de las transiciones animadas que mejoran la experiencia visual al controlar el foco atencional.
Principios técnicos para un movimiento fluido y natural
Para que una animación sea efectiva, debe imitar las leyes de la física del mundo real. Una animación mecánica o lineal suele percibirse como artificial y molesta.
La importancia del Easing y las curvas de aceleración
En la realidad, los objetos no alcanzan su velocidad máxima instantáneamente ni se detienen en seco. El uso de funciones de temporización como cubic-bezier en CSS permite crear movimientos que aceleran suavemente al inicio y desaceleran al final (ease-in-out). Esto hace que la transición se sienta orgánica y profesional.
Duración y persistencia visual
La regla de oro para la duración de las transiciones en 2026 es:
Microinteracciones: 100ms - 200ms.
Transiciones de página o menús: 300ms - 500ms.
Animaciones de fondo o ambientales: Más de 1000ms (lentas y sutiles).
Superar estos tiempos puede frustrar al usuario que busca eficiencia, mientras que quedarse corto puede hacer que el movimiento pase desapercibido.
Cómo aplicar transiciones sin afectar el rendimiento web
Uno de los mayores desafíos al implementar transiciones animadas que mejoran la experiencia visual es no comprometer las métricas de velocidad de Google (Core Web Vitals).
Optimización por hardware: CSS vs JavaScript
Para que una transición sea fluida (60 fotogramas por segundo), debemos evitar animar propiedades que obliguen al navegador a recalcular el diseño (layout) o la pintura (paint).
Propiedades recomendadas:
transform(para mover, escalar o rotar) yopacity. Estas son gestionadas por la GPU del dispositivo.Propiedades a evitar:
height,width,margin,top/left. Estas obligan al navegador a reordenar el resto de los elementos de la página, causando saltos visuales y lentitud.
El uso de Skeleton Screens como transición de carga
En lugar de un icono giratorio de "cargando", las transiciones de esqueleto muestran una estructura gris que imita la disposición final del contenido. Esto actúa como una transición de baja fidelidad que reduce la ansiedad del usuario y hace que la carga final del contenido se sienta como una culminación natural de la animación de espera.
Accesibilidad en las transiciones animadas
Un diseño profesional en 2026 debe ser inclusivo. Algunas personas sufren de trastornos vestibulares que pueden causar mareos ante movimientos bruscos en pantalla.
Respetar las preferencias de movimiento reducido
Es fundamental configurar nuestras hojas de estilo para detectar si el usuario ha activado la opción de "reducir movimiento" en su sistema operativo. En esos casos, las transiciones complejas deben sustituirse por un fundido suave (fade-in) o eliminarse por completo.
@media (prefers-reduced-motion: reduce) {
* {
animation-duration: 0.01ms !important;
transition-duration: 0.01ms !important;
}
}
Herramientas para diseñar y prototipar transiciones de alto nivel
Para los profesionales que buscan implementar estas estrategias, existen herramientas líderes que facilitan la experimentación antes de pasar al código.
Figma (Smart Animate): Permite crear prototipos con transiciones automáticas que reconocen elementos similares entre pantallas, ideal para probar la continuidad espacial.
Framer: Ofrece un control granular sobre la física del movimiento, permitiendo exportar animaciones que se traducen casi directamente a código React.
Lottie (Adobe BodyMovin): Permite integrar animaciones vectoriales complejas (hechas en After Effects) de forma ligera y escalable, manteniendo la nitidez en cualquier resolución.
Conclusión:
Dominar las transiciones animadas que mejoran la experiencia visual es dar un paso adelante hacia la madurez digital. El movimiento no es un añadido; es la gramática que permite al usuario leer tu interfaz con fluidez y placer. Al aplicar principios de física, optimización técnica y respeto por la accesibilidad, no solo estarás creando un sitio web "bonito", sino una herramienta de comunicación potente y humana.
En un mercado donde la atención es el recurso más preciado, la fluidez visual es tu mejor aliada para retener al usuario y guiarlo suavemente hacia tus objetivos de conversión. No animes por decorar, anima para comunicar.
No hay comentarios:
Publicar un comentario